공개 최종 클래스 OptimizerOptions
Options passed to the graph optimizerProtobuf 유형
tensorflow.OptimizerOptions
중첩 클래스
수업 | OptimizerOptions.Builder | Options passed to the graph optimizerProtobuf 유형 tensorflow.OptimizerOptions | |
열거형 | OptimizerOptions.GlobalJitLevel | Control the use of the compiler/jit. | |
열거형 | OptimizerOptions.레벨 | Optimization levelProtobuf 열거형 tensorflow.OptimizerOptions.Level |
상수
공개 방법
부울 | 같음 (객체 객체) |
정적 최적화 옵션 | |
최적화 옵션 | |
최종 정적 com.google.protobuf.Descriptors.Descriptor | |
부울 | getDoCommonSubexpressionElimination () If true, optimize the graph using common subexpression elimination. |
부울 | getDoConstantFolding () If true, perform constant folding optimization on the graph. |
부울 | getDoFunctionInlining () If true, perform function inlining on the graph. |
OptimizerOptions.GlobalJitLevel | getGlobalJit레벨 () .tensorflow.OptimizerOptions.GlobalJitLevel global_jit_level = 5; |
정수 | getGlobalJit레벨값 () .tensorflow.OptimizerOptions.GlobalJitLevel global_jit_level = 5; |
긴 | getMaxFoldedConstantInBytes () Constant folding optimization replaces tensors whose values can be predetermined, with constant nodes. |
OptimizerOptions.레벨 | getOpt레벨 () Overall optimization level. |
정수 | getOpt레벨값 () Overall optimization level. |
정수 | |
최종 com.google.protobuf.UnknownFieldSet | |
정수 | 해시코드 () |
최종 부울 | 초기화됨 () |
정적 OptimizerOptions.Builder | newBuilder ( OptimizerOptions 프로토타입) |
정적 OptimizerOptions.Builder | 새로운 빌더 () |
OptimizerOptions.Builder | |
정적 최적화 옵션 | parsDelimitedFrom (InputStream 입력) |
정적 최적화 옵션 | parseDelimitedFrom (InputStream 입력,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ry) |
정적 최적화 옵션 | parsFrom (ByteBuffer 데이터) |
정적 최적화 옵션 | ParseFrom (com.google.protobuf.CodedInputStream 입력,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ry) |
정적 최적화 옵션 | ParseFrom (ByteBuffer 데이터,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ry) |
정적 최적화 옵션 | ParseFrom (com.google.protobuf.CodedInputStream 입력) |
정적 최적화 옵션 | parseFrom (byte[] 데이터, com.google.protobuf.ExtensionRegistryLite 확장Registry) |
정적 최적화 옵션 | ParseFrom (com.google.protobuf.ByteString 데이터) |
정적 최적화 옵션 | ParseFrom (InputStream 입력,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ry) |
정적 최적화 옵션 | ParseFrom (com.google.protobuf.ByteString 데이터,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ry) |
공전 | 파서 () |
OptimizerOptions.Builder | toBuilder () |
무효의 | writeTo (com.google.protobuf.CodedOutputStream 출력) |
상속된 메서드
상수
공개 정적 최종 int DO_COMMON_SUBEXPRESSION_ELIMINATION_FIELD_NUMBER
상수값: 1
공개 정적 최종 int DO_CONSTANT_FOLDING_FIELD_NUMBER
상수값: 2
공개 정적 최종 int DO_FUNCTION_INLINING_FIELD_NUMBER
상수값: 4
공개 정적 최종 int GLOBAL_JIT_LEVEL_FIELD_NUMBER
상수값: 5
공개 정적 최종 int MAX_FOLDED_CONSTANT_IN_BYTES_FIELD_NUMBER
상수값: 6
공개 정적 최종 int OPT_LEVEL_FIELD_NUMBER
상수값: 3
공개 방법
공개 부울은 (객체 obj) 와 같습니다 .
공개 정적 최종 com.google.protobuf.Descriptors.Descriptor getDescriptor ()
공개 부울 getDoCommonSubexpressionElimination ()
If true, optimize the graph using common subexpression elimination.
bool do_common_subexpression_elimination = 1;
공개 부울 getDoConstantFolding ()
If true, perform constant folding optimization on the graph.
bool do_constant_folding = 2;
공개 부울 getDoFunctionInlining ()
If true, perform function inlining on the graph.
bool do_function_inlining = 4;
공개 OptimizerOptions.GlobalJitLevel getGlobalJitLevel ()
.tensorflow.OptimizerOptions.GlobalJitLevel global_jit_level = 5;
공개 int getGlobalJitLevelValue ()
.tensorflow.OptimizerOptions.GlobalJitLevel global_jit_level = 5;
공개 긴 getMaxFoldedConstantInBytes ()
Constant folding optimization replaces tensors whose values can be predetermined, with constant nodes. To avoid inserting too large constants, the size of each constant created can be limited. If this value is zero, a default limit of 10 MiB will be applied. If constant folding optimization is disabled, this value is ignored.
int64 max_folded_constant_in_bytes = 6;
공개 OptimizerOptions.Level getOptLevel ()
Overall optimization level. The actual optimizations applied will be the logical OR of the flags that this level implies and any flags already set.
.tensorflow.OptimizerOptions.Level opt_level = 3;
공개 int getOptLevelValue ()
Overall optimization level. The actual optimizations applied will be the logical OR of the flags that this level implies and any flags already set.
.tensorflow.OptimizerOptions.Level opt_level = 3;
공공의 getParserForType ()
공개 int getSerializedSize ()
공개 최종 com.google.protobuf.UnknownFieldSet getUnknownFields ()
공개 int hashCode ()
공개 최종 부울 isInitialized ()
공개 정적 OptimizerOptionsparseDelimitedFrom ( InputStream 입력,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ry)
던지기
IO예외 |
---|
공개 정적 OptimizerOptions parseFrom (com.google.protobuf.CodedInputStream 입력,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ry)
던지기
IO예외 |
---|
공개 정적 OptimizerOptions parsFrom (ByteBuffer 데이터,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ry)
던지기
잘못된프로토콜버퍼예외 |
---|
공개 정적 OptimizerOptions 구문 분석 (byte[] 데이터,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ry)
던지기
잘못된프로토콜버퍼예외 |
---|
공개 정적 OptimizerOptions parseFrom (InputStream 입력,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ry)
던지기
IO예외 |
---|
공개 정적 OptimizerOptions 구문 분석기 (com.google.protobuf.ByteString 데이터,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ry)
던지기
잘못된프로토콜버퍼예외 |
---|
공개 정적 파서 ()
공개 무효 writeTo (com.google.protobuf.CodedOutputStream 출력)
던지기
IO예외 |
---|